EU16 LTE is a 2016 Peugeot 2008 in Black with a 1,560c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 9 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 88.9%.
Across all 2016 Peugeot 2008 models, the average MOT pass rate is 80.8% with a typical mileage of 43,056 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The Peugeot 2008 typically stays on UK roads for around 13 years. At 10 years old, this Peugeot 2008 is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
